Chart.AlignDataPointsByAxisLabel Yöntem

Tanım

Veri noktalarını eksen etiketlerini kullanarak hizalar.

Aşırı Yüklemeler

Name Description
AlignDataPointsByAxisLabel()

Veri noktalarını, eksen etiketlerini kullanarak X ekseni boyunca hizalar. Birden çok serinin dizini ve X değerleri dize olduğunda geçerlidir.

AlignDataPointsByAxisLabel(String)

Farklı serilerdeki veri noktalarını, eksen etiketlerini kullanarak X ekseni boyunca hizalar. Grafikte belirtilen seri artan sıralama düzeni kullanılarak hizalanır.

AlignDataPointsByAxisLabel(PointSortOrder)

Veri noktalarını eksen etiketlerini kullanarak hizalar. Grafikteki tüm seriler, belirtilen sıralama düzeni kullanılarak hizalanır.

AlignDataPointsByAxisLabel(String, PointSortOrder)

Veri noktalarını eksen etiketlerini kullanarak hizalar.

AlignDataPointsByAxisLabel()

Veri noktalarını, eksen etiketlerini kullanarak X ekseni boyunca hizalar. Birden çok serinin dizini ve X değerleri dize olduğunda geçerlidir.

public:
 void AlignDataPointsByAxisLabel();
public void AlignDataPointsByAxisLabel();
member this.AlignDataPointsByAxisLabel : unit -> unit
Public Sub AlignDataPointsByAxisLabel ()

Şunlara uygulanır

AlignDataPointsByAxisLabel(String)

Farklı serilerdeki veri noktalarını, eksen etiketlerini kullanarak X ekseni boyunca hizalar. Grafikte belirtilen seri artan sıralama düzeni kullanılarak hizalanır.

public:
 void AlignDataPointsByAxisLabel(System::String ^ series);
public void AlignDataPointsByAxisLabel(string series);
member this.AlignDataPointsByAxisLabel : string -> unit
Public Sub AlignDataPointsByAxisLabel (series As String)

Parametreler

series
String

Veri noktası eksen etiketlerini kullanarak veri noktalarınıN X eksenine hizalanmış olmasını sağlayacak, virgülle ayrılmış seri listesi.

Açıklamalar

Bu yöntem, eksen etiketlerini kullanarak X ekseni boyunca farklı serilerden veri noktalarını hizalamak için kullanılır ve aşağıdaki durumlarda geçerlidir:

  • Birden çok seri görüntülenir ve dizine eklenir; diğer bir XValue ifadeyle, tüm veri noktalarının 0 veya IsXValueIndexed özelliği olur true.

  • Tüm veri noktalarına özgü Seriesboş olmayan eksen etiketleri vardır. Bunlar benzersiz değilse, bir özel durum oluşturulur.

Bu durum, veri bağlama birden çok serinin oluşturulmasıyla sonuçlandığında ve string değerler X ekseni değerleri için kullanıldığında çok yaygındır.

Birden çok, dizine alınan seriler çizildiğinde ve X değerleri değerler kullanılarak string ayarlandığında iki sorun ortaya çıkar:

  • X değerleri aynı dizeye sahip farklı serilerdeki veri noktalarının X ekseni boyunca aynı dizinde çizileceği garanti edilemez.

  • Aynı dizine sahip diğer serilerdeki veri noktalarının eksen etiketleri de olsa, yalnızca ilk serideki veri noktaları için eksen etiketi görüntülenir.

Varsayılan olarak, noktalar serilerinde depolandıkları sırayla çizilir. Sıralama düzeni belirtmek için parametresi olan sortingOrder bir AlignDataPointsByAxisLabel yöntem aşırı yüklemesini kullanın.

Şunlara uygulanır

AlignDataPointsByAxisLabel(PointSortOrder)

Veri noktalarını eksen etiketlerini kullanarak hizalar. Grafikteki tüm seriler, belirtilen sıralama düzeni kullanılarak hizalanır.

public:
 void AlignDataPointsByAxisLabel(System::Web::UI::DataVisualization::Charting::PointSortOrder sortingOrder);
public void AlignDataPointsByAxisLabel(System.Web.UI.DataVisualization.Charting.PointSortOrder sortingOrder);
member this.AlignDataPointsByAxisLabel : System.Web.UI.DataVisualization.Charting.PointSortOrder -> unit
Public Sub AlignDataPointsByAxisLabel (sortingOrder As PointSortOrder)

Parametreler

sortingOrder
PointSortOrder

PointSortOrder Eksen etiketlerinde artan veya azalan sıralama düzeninin kullanılıp kullanılmadığını belirten ve daha önce aynı eksen alanını kaplayan noktaların görüntülenme sırasını belirleyen nesne.

Şunlara uygulanır

AlignDataPointsByAxisLabel(String, PointSortOrder)

Veri noktalarını eksen etiketlerini kullanarak hizalar.

public:
 void AlignDataPointsByAxisLabel(System::String ^ series, System::Web::UI::DataVisualization::Charting::PointSortOrder sortingOrder);
public void AlignDataPointsByAxisLabel(string series, System.Web.UI.DataVisualization.Charting.PointSortOrder sortingOrder);
member this.AlignDataPointsByAxisLabel : string * System.Web.UI.DataVisualization.Charting.PointSortOrder -> unit
Public Sub AlignDataPointsByAxisLabel (series As String, sortingOrder As PointSortOrder)

Parametreler

series
String

Eksen etiketiyle hizalanması gereken, virgülle ayrılmış seri listesi.

sortingOrder
PointSortOrder

PointSortOrder Eksen etiketlerinde artan veya azalan sıralama düzeninin kullanılıp kullanılmadığını belirleyen ve daha önce aynı eksen alanını kaplayan noktaların görüntülenme sırasını belirleyen bir numaralandırma değeri.

Açıklamalar

Bu yöntem, eksen etiketlerini kullanarak X ekseni boyunca farklı serilerden veri noktalarını hizalamak için kullanılır ve aşağıdaki durumlarda geçerlidir:

  • Birden çok seri görüntülenir ve dizine eklenir; diğer bir XValue ifadeyle, tüm veri noktalarının 0 veya IsXValueIndexed özelliği olur true.

  • Tüm veri noktalarına özgü Seriesboş olmayan eksen etiketleri vardır. Bunlar benzersiz değilse, bir özel durum oluşturulur.

Bu durum, veri bağlama birden çok serinin oluşturulmasıyla sonuçlandığında ve string değerler X ekseni değerleri için kullanıldığında çok yaygındır.

Birden çok, dizine alınan seriler çizildiğinde ve X değerleri değerler kullanılarak string ayarlandığında iki sorun ortaya çıkar:

  • X değerleri aynı dizeye sahip farklı serilerdeki veri noktalarının X ekseni boyunca aynı dizinde çizileceği garanti edilemez.

  • Aynı dizine sahip diğer serilerdeki veri noktalarının eksen etiketleri de olsa, yalnızca ilk serideki veri noktaları için eksen etiketi görüntülenir.

Varsayılan olarak, noktalar serilerinde depolandıkları sırayla çizilir. Sıralama düzeni belirtmek için parametresi olan sortingOrder bir AlignDataPointsByAxisLabel yöntem aşırı yüklemesini kullanın.

Şunlara uygulanır